Output 728097babe82070c5f39c6e0877e235f4333106eaa4a939add036b7d54e0c62e:15

value
30000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d54938b45cc38502ff9eec7c7d30a498984ba6f OP_EQUAL
address
3Bf6tvMNDznZd2fuLoi2Ea4G9uipSbTvE6
transaction
728097babe82070c5f39c6e0877e235f4333106eaa4a939add036b7d54e0c62e
spent
true